Full Title: 2nd Leipzig Students' Conference in Linguistics Short Title: LESCOL
Organized by Fachschaftsrat Linguistik (Linguistics Student Association) LESCOL will take place 1st of September at the University of Leipzig, providing a great opportunity to present in the context of SSLT.
Call for Papers
We invite students of linguistics to give talks dealing with research topics in any area of linguistics at the 2nd Leipzig Students' Conference in Linguistics (LESCOL) which will take place in the context of the DGfS-CNRS Summer School on Linguistic Typology (SSLT).
Talks will be 30 minutes plus 15 minutes for discussion and can be given in English (preferred), French or German.
Please send your proposals until May 31st to studentsconferenceuni- leipzig.de.Your anonymous abstract should be no longer than one page (excluding references) and in pdf- or doc-format. Please indicate your name, the title of your talk and your home university in the body of the e-mail. Abstracts will be reviewed by a group of advanced-level students appointed by the Fachschaftsrat.
